U.S. GDP Sales Surge to 3.0% in Q3 2024, Marking Significant Growth

The United States has reported a significant increase in GDP sales for the third quarter of 2024, according to the latest update on November 27, 2024. The GDP sales climbed to 3.0%, marking a significant improvement from the previous quarter's figure of 1.9%.

This notable growth in GDP sales underscores a robust economic expansion during this period, highlighting resilience amidst various global economic challenges. Analysts point towards a strong domestic market and increased consumer spending as potential drivers behind this impressive upturn.

The latest figures frame an optimistic outlook for the U.S. economy, with stakeholders awaiting further data to assess whether this growth trajectory can be sustained into the next fiscal period.
